Smoking Cessasation
The Powell County Health Department will offer the Cooper/Clayton program to stop smoking beginning on Wednesday, Jan. 2 at 4:30 p.m. at the Powell County Extension Office. The program will meet for 13 weeks and is free. Participants will be responsible for purchasing nicotine replacement products, however graduates will be reimbursed for 50 percent of the money spent on these products at the completion of the program. Vets Representative
A Veterans Benefits Field Representative will be at the Powell County Courthouse, Stanton, on the first Thursday of each month from 9-11:30 a.m. Veterans and their families will be given counseling in filing for federal and state veterans benefits.
